The New York Yankees are facing significant challenges heading into the 2025 MLB season.

As spring training begins, Yankees slugger Giancarlo Stanton is dealing with injuries to both of his elbows. To make matters worse, it was later revealed that he’s also struggling with a calf injury.

In a season preview for every MLB team, insiders Russell Dorsey, Jake Mintz, and Jordan Shusterman from Yahoo outlined the worst-case scenario for the Yankees, which includes Stanton not playing a single game in 2025.

The article read, “It turns out that replacing Juan Soto and Gerrit Cole is extremely difficult. Judge desperately misses Soto’s presence in the lineup, as recent additions such as Cody Bellinger, Paul Goldschmidt, and Jazz Chisholm fail to step up. Giancarlo Stanton, sidelined by two ailing elbows, doesn’t play a single game.”

If Stanton is unable to play at all in 2025, it would be a major setback for the Yankees’ roster.

Stanton is under a 13-year, $325.5 million contract with the Yankees. Last season, he hit .233 with 27 home runs and 72 RBIs, while in the playoffs, he batted .273 with 7 home runs and 16 RBIs.

Stanton’s Injury Concerns
Stanton has been battling both elbow and calf injuries. Currently rehabbing, Yankees general manager Brian Cashman has stated that surgery is not being ruled out, though it would be a last resort.

“It’d be a last resort,” Cashman said. “I can’t rule out surgery, but I know it’s not recommended in the front end of this thing. But obviously, if you have a number of different failed attempts, then you start looking at different ways of intervention.”

If Stanton requires surgery, it could put his entire season in jeopardy. However, Stanton remains focused on doing whatever it takes to return to the field.

“It’s a long year,” Stanton said. “These (injuries) happen throughout the year. You don’t want them to happen off the bat, but you understand and consider they happen every year, unfortunately, to a different number of guys. It’s just the mentality of holding the fort down until everybody gets healthy.”

The Yankees are set to open the 2025 MLB season at home on March 27 against the Milwaukee Brewers.

Yankees Expected to Be Wild Card Team
With Stanton, Gerrit Cole, and Luis Gil all dealing with injuries, the insiders don’t expect the Yankees to find much success in 2025.

Although the Yankees won the AL East last season and made it to the World Series, the loss of Juan Soto in free agency, combined with the injuries, has led the writers to predict the Yankees won’t repeat as AL East champions.

“The Yankees miss Soto much more than they miss Cole, but Judge does enough to carry the supporting cast to 90 wins and a wild-card berth,” the article stated. “Volpe emerges, and Chisholm is solid, but the rest of the lineup underwhelms. It’s a decent, ultimately disappointing Yankees season that pushes the franchise one year closer to ending the Judge Era without a ring.”

Being a wild card team would be a letdown for New York, given their dominance in the AL East last season.

Currently, the Yankees have the third-best odds of winning the World Series at +850, which suggests a 10.5% chance.
